Introduction
A generic pharmaceutical company is looking for a Group Brand Manager who will be responsible for the strategic planning development and execution of marketing strategies across a portfolio of pharmaceutical brands.
Duties & Responsibilities
- Brand Strategy & Planning: Develop and implement integrated marketing strategies for assigned product portfolio.
- Conduct SWOT analyses and build brand plans including positioning segmentation and messaging.
- Lead annual brand planning and forecasting in coordination with finance and sales.
- Portfolio Management: Manage the lifecycle of each product including launches line extensions and discontinuations.
- Monitor performance metrics and optimize marketing mix accordingly.
- Identify and evaluate new opportunities to expand or improve the product portfolio.
- Promotional & Campaign Management: Lead development of promotional materials and multi-channel campaigns (digital, print, in-person).
- Ensure all promotional activities comply with regulatory and company standards.
- Coordinate with medical, regulatory and legal departments for approval processes.
- Stakeholder Engagement: Partner with KOLs, HCPs and external agencies to support brand awareness and education.
- Support the sales force through training, marketing tools and clear brand communication.
- Engage with market access, tender and government teams where relevant to ensure commercial alignment.
- Market Intelligence: Analyse market trends, competitor activity and customer insights to inform strategic decisions.
- Monitor sales data, CRM outputs and marketing KPIs to assess effectiveness.
- Budget & Compliance: Manage brand budgets and ensure cost-effective use of resources.
- Ensure strict adherence to pharma marketing compliance and internal SOPs.
